Posted: 9/27/2009 9:01pm et
The Associated Press reports Philadelphia Eagles RB LeSean McCoy had 20 carries for 84 yards with a touchdown Week 3.
The Huddle Take: McCoy was tremendous filling in for the injured Brian Westbrook in Philadelphia and certainly proved he is capable of carrying the load if given the opportunity. With Westbrook continuing to have injury problems it would not be out of the realm of possibilities to see McCoy take on more of a consistent role on offense even when Westbrook returns to action.

Posted: 8/5/2009 6:19pm et
Philadelphia Eagles head coach Andy Reid said RB LeSean McCoy has been doing well at picking up the blitz so far during training camp. "He's aggressive. Can he work a little bit on his technique? Yeah, that's what he doing. But I'll tell you what, he's had some pick ups as we've gone along here," Reid said.
The Huddle Take: Pass protection is one of the trickiest things for rookie backs to pick up, but it's critical if they are to remain on the field in passing situations. That McCoy's pass pro has impressed Reid suggests that the Eagles wouldn't miss a beat if Brian Westbrook's injury forced Philly to use more McCoy at the start of the season.
Posted: 6/7/2009 12:29am et
Philadelphia Eagles head coach Andy Reid said backup RB LeSean McCoy has a great change of direction and the ability to catch the football. "We're asking him to do a lot of things formation-wise; he's able to handle that," Reid said. "He's really done well, and it looks like he does a nice job in the blitz pick-up part of it. Again, it's not live. We're just asking him to recognize it and step in there and do that, so he's done well with that." Reid said they'll put a split on McCoy's injured thumb and he'll return to action next week.
The Huddle Take: Assuming the thumb injury doesn't set McCoy back as he learns the Philly offense, he appears set to at minimum provide fantasy value as Brian Westbrook insurance. And with Westy already on the shelf following ankle surgery, McCoy's impact could come sooner rather than later.
Posted: 4/27/2009 12:25pm et
Philadelphia Eagles head coach Andy Reid said rookie RB LeSean McCoy catches the football "extremely well" and he will give the team depth at running back. On whether or not he'll be the team's No. 2 running back, Reid said: "We'll see how he is and how he picks everything up." In regards to McCoy's blocking ability, Reid said that is something he is going to need to work on. McCoy said Reid told him twice that his blocking will need work, which he is fine with. "I think everybody has something they can improve on," McCoy said.
The Huddle Take: It's no shock a rookie back will need to improve in pass protection. How quickly McCoy gets onto the field—and how long he stays there—will depend heavily on how quickly he can pick up this critical skill.
Posted: 4/27/2009 11:10am et
The Philadelphia Eagles have selected University of Pittsburgh RB LeSean McCoy with the 53rd overall pick in the 2009 NFL Draft.
The Huddle Take: McCoy will start his career in Philly by spelling Brian Westbrook, making him a must-handcuff fantasy pick for the oft-nicked Eagle. McCoy is also situated to eventually take over Westbrook's role.
